質粒簡介 |
人類Ubiquiitin基因有四個,編碼同一個蛋白,稱為Ubiquitin分子,這四個基因的mRNA水平存在些許差異,但是蛋白序列是一樣的。其中最常見的是Ubiquitin C(UBC)、Ubiquitin B(UBB)基因,UBC mRNA編碼六個重復的Ubiquitin分子,UBB編碼四個重復的Ubquitin分子,所以外源克隆的HA-UB一般只克隆了一個ub分子,也就只有76個氨基酸,如果您需要連續(xù)幾個Ub的那種,可以委托我們做亞克隆,HA-ub(n),n=1.2.3.4.5.6..... Homo sapiens ubiquitin C (UBC), mRNA,NCBI Reference Sequence: NM_021009.6 |
